San Juan
General Information
#31466A, commonly referred to as San Juan, is a muted, deep blue hue that exudes sophistication and calmness. It belongs to the blue color family and carries a sense of depth and stability. The color is named after San Juan, potentially evoking the sea and sky. In the RGB color model, #31466A is composed of 19.22% red, 27.45% green, and 41.57% blue. Its CMYK values are 0.54, 0.33, 0.00, 0.58. This hexadecimal color is commonly used in web design, graphic design, and branding to convey a sense of professionalism, trust, and reliability. The color is suitable for a wide range of industries, including technology, finance, and healthcare.
The hex color #31466A, also known as San Juan, presents some accessibility challenges. Its relatively low luminance value means that text rendered in this color may require careful consideration of contrast ratios against background colors. According to WCAG guidelines, a cont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is recommended for normal-sized text and 3:1 for large text (14pt bold or 18pt regular) to ensure readability for users with visual impairments. When using #31466A for text or important UI elements, it is crucial to pair it with a light background color to meet these contrast requirements. Conversely, if #31466A is used as a background color, employing light-colored text will enhance accessibility. Tools like contrast checkers can help verify compliance with accessibility standards.

Applications
Web Design
In web design, #31466A can serve as a sophisticated background color for headers or sidebars, providing a sense of depth and professionalism. It pairs well with lighter text colors such as whites or creams to ensure readability. This color is also suitable for creating subtle visual hierarchies within a webpage, guiding the user's eye to important content areas. Furthermore, it can be used to define the brand identity by incorporating it into the color scheme of the website, logos, and other visual elements.
